Choosing the Right Software: To start creating realistic clear plastic models, selecting the appropriate software is crucial. Programs like Blender, AutoCAD, and SketchUp offer features designed to simulate various materials, including clear plastics. Look for software that allows you to adjust opacity, refraction settings, and surface attributes to accurately depict your model. It’s essential to choose a tool that supports advanced rendering techniques, as this will greatly enhance the visualization of light behavior as it interacts with your clear plastic model. Techniques for Modeling Clear Plastic: 1. **Material Properties**: Set the material properties to reflect how clear plastic behaves. This includes tweaking transparency levels and adding a slight shininess to give it that polished look. Ensure that your settings also include a refractive index that mimics real-world clear plastics. Are you familiar with how to adjust material settings in your modeling program? Properly configuring these parameters will significantly influence the realism of your models. 2. **Lighting**: Proper lighting is key when showcasing clear plastic. Experiment with different light angles, intensities, and color temperatures to create reflections and highlights that enhance the clarity and depth of your model. Understanding how to manipulate shadows will also help provide a three-dimensional feel. Rendering Your 3D Model: Once you've finished your model, the rendering process is your next step. This is where the magic happens. Utilize realistic rendering settings that accurately reflect the unique characteristics of clear plastic. Many rendering engines can simulate how light travels through and reflects off clear materials, providing lifelike visual outputs. It's important to test different rendering approaches to find the one that enhances your specific model best.
